New Release Celebrates ABBA Eurovision Win in 1974

ABBA: 1974
Forty years ago today, ABBA performed Waterloo at the Eurovision Song Contest and it has since entered the competition's archives as the best song (so far).

To celebrate this landmark anniversary, the group's second studio album of the same name has been expanded with eight bonus tracks. To make this a truly deluxe release, fans will also receive a DVD of previously unreleased television material, including appearances from the BBC's Top of the Pops.

You'll also get to see the group performing Waterloo at Melodifestivalen and the Contest, as well as rare performances of Honey, Honey. To top it all off, there's also an interview with Frida and Stig after the Eurovision victory. 

Full CD bonus material:
  • Ring, Ring (U.S. remix 1974)  
  • Waterloo (Swedish Version) 
  • Honey, Honey (Swedish version) 
  • Waterloo (German version) 
  • Hasta Mañana (Spanish version) 
  • Waterloo (French version) 
  • Ring Ring (1974 remix, Single version) 
  • Waterloo (Alternate mix)
Bonus DVD material:
  • Waterloo (Eurovision Song Contest Performance I, BBC)
  • Waterloo (Melodifestivalen Performance I, SVT)
  • Waterloo (Melodifestivalen Performance II, SVT)
  • Waterloo (Eurovision Song Contest Preview Performance, SVT)
  • Waterloo (Eurovision Song Contest Performance II, BBC) Interview with Frida and Stig After the Eurovision Victory (Rapport, SVT)
  • Waterloo (Top Of The Pops Performance I, BBC)
  • Honey, Honey (Disco, ZDF)
  • Waterloo (Top Of The Pops Performance II, BBC)
  • Honey, Honey (Spotlight, ORF)
  • Waterloo (German version) (Musik aus Studio B, NDR)
  • Honey, Honey (Ein Kessel Buntes, Fernsehen der DDR)
  • Waterloo (Top Of The Pops Performance III, BBC)
  • International Sleeve Gallery

The collection also includes a 20-page booklet which throws more light on the making of the Waterloo album, together with some very fine images from the period.
